Laser machining system and method for machining three-dimensional objects from a plurality of directions |
摘要 |
Embodiments of the present disclosure are directed to systems (300), devices and methods for machining a work-piece from a plurality of directions using a single laser beam and galvanometer scan head (302). In some embodiments, such a system includes, for example, a scanning galvanometer head (“scan-head”) (302), having one or more mirrors (323) for directing a laser beam in at least one plane. Preferably, in some embodiments, the scan-head includes two mirrors for deflecting the laser beam in the at least one plane (e.g., an X-Y plane). A plurality of second mirrors (312A, 312B, 312C) is arranged after the scan-head (302) to direct the laser onto a predetermined portion of the exterior of the object to be machined. In some preferred embodiments, there are three such second mirrors (312A, 312B, 312C) each to direct the laser over a 120 degree area of the object. In some embodiments, a single, large-field focusing lens is also included to focus the laser output from the scan-head, while in other embodiments, each second mirror includes a corresponding focusing lens (316A, 316B, 316C). One or more of the beams effecting machining of the work-piece may be unfolded. |

主权项 |
1. A laser machining system for machining a work-piece comprising:
a laser scanning head that receives a laser beam and redirects the laser beam within a first angular range; and two or more optical sub-systems positioned external to the laser scanning head and each receiving separately and at different times the laser beam from the laser scanning head over a second angular range within the first angular range, wherein each of the two or more optical sub-systems includes at least one focusing lens to focus the laser beam within a channel corresponding to a specific portion of the work-piece to be machined by the laser beam. |
